ultraviolet sterilizer

简明释义

紫外线杀菌器

英英释义

A device that uses ultraviolet light to kill or inactivate microorganisms, such as bacteria and viruses, to disinfect surfaces, air, or water.

一种利用紫外线光杀死或使微生物(如细菌和病毒)失活的设备,用于消毒表面、空气或水。

In recent years, the importance of maintaining hygiene and cleanliness has gained unprecedented attention. One of the most effective tools in achieving this is the ultraviolet sterilizer (紫外线消毒器). This device utilizes ultraviolet light to eliminate bacteria, viruses, and other harmful microorganisms from various surfaces and air. Understanding how a ultraviolet sterilizer works and its benefits can help individuals and businesses make informed decisions about their sanitation practices.The principle behind a ultraviolet sterilizer is relatively simple. Ultraviolet light, particularly UV-C light, has a wavelength that can disrupt the DNA or RNA of microorganisms, rendering them incapable of reproduction and infection. This means that when these pathogens are exposed to UV-C light for a specific duration, they are effectively killed or inactivated. Therefore, a ultraviolet sterilizer can be a powerful ally in the fight against germs, especially in settings like hospitals, laboratories, and even homes.One of the primary advantages of using a ultraviolet sterilizer is its speed and efficiency. Unlike traditional cleaning methods that may require chemical solutions and extended contact time, UV sterilization can be completed in a matter of minutes. For instance, a ultraviolet sterilizer can quickly disinfect a room or equipment without leaving any residue, making it safe for immediate use afterward. This rapid action is particularly beneficial in high-traffic areas where quick turnaround times are essential.Moreover, a ultraviolet sterilizer is eco-friendly. It does not rely on harsh chemicals that could potentially harm the environment or human health. Instead, it uses light to achieve disinfection, which means there are no toxic byproducts to worry about. In an era where sustainability is becoming increasingly important, opting for a ultraviolet sterilizer can align with environmentally conscious practices.However, it is crucial to note that while a ultraviolet sterilizer is highly effective, it should not be seen as a standalone solution. Proper cleaning procedures should still be followed to remove dirt and organic matter, as UV light cannot penetrate through these barriers. Additionally, safety precautions must be taken when using a ultraviolet sterilizer, as direct exposure to UV-C light can be harmful to skin and eyes. Users should always follow manufacturer guidelines and ensure that the area is unoccupied during the sterilization process.In conclusion, the ultraviolet sterilizer (紫外线消毒器) represents a significant advancement in sterilization technology. Its ability to quickly and effectively eliminate harmful microorganisms makes it an invaluable tool in various settings. As we continue to prioritize health and safety, understanding and utilizing devices like the ultraviolet sterilizer can contribute to a cleaner and safer environment for everyone. By integrating such technologies into our daily routines, we can enhance our efforts to combat infectious diseases and promote overall well-being.
